Output e3af9ad128154ec6826629fbd9988b7d9e70fc5254ef6ca4a440aebcbaa112c8:0

value
4341294
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01ae1620bec829df45a21a8c1581ee2b493d7ee1 OP_EQUALVERIFY OP_CHECKSIG
address
19tDvuxh2XAyPvgTqNuG66Keri925DZpW
transaction
e3af9ad128154ec6826629fbd9988b7d9e70fc5254ef6ca4a440aebcbaa112c8
spent
true